NeighbourhoodThis rental home on Fazantstraat in Gennep sits on a spacious plot of 610 m², giving you plenty of outdoor space. The 60 m² interior is compact but efficient, and with energy label C, running costs are moderate. At €1,025 per month, the rent is well below the neighbourhood average of €1,705, making it a keen option compared to other semi-detached houses in Gennep.
The neighbourhood Midden has around 4,000 residents, with a mix of families and older households. One resident says: "Child-friendly and mostly quiet neighbourhood. The roads and rental homes have recently been renovated, which has significantly improved the appearance of the area." Another notes: "I like living here. I only miss a train station. And there are often groups of teenagers in the neighbourhood who think they are above the law. But otherwise I am more than satisfied." A third review mentions loitering youths but adds it's "quite cosy, everyone chats with each other." Based on three reviews, the neighbourhood scores 6.84 out of 10.
For your groceries, Albert Heijn is just around the corner, with Aldi and Lidl a couple of streets away. There are several primary schools within a five-minute walk, including Basisschool De Ratel and Basisschool Stella Nova. The municipality Gennep offers a park or public garden a short stroll away, and a restaurant is also nearby. The nearest train station is 8.6 km away, so a car or bus is handy for longer journeys.
